The first step in pet turtle care is creating a suitable habitat. Turtles require a specific environment to thrive, which includes proper temperature, lighting, and water quality.
Your turtle’s tank size will depend on its species and size. A general rule of thumb is to provide at least 10 gallons of water for every inch of the turtle’s shell. Here are some considerations when choosing a tank:

Proper heating and lighting are essential for your turtle’s health. Turtles need a basking area where they can warm up and UVB lighting to help them absorb calcium.
Feeding your turtle a balanced diet is a vital aspect of pet turtle care. Turtles are omnivores and require a mix of protein and plant-based foods.

Young turtles should be fed daily, while adults can be fed every other day. Monitor your turtle’s eating habits and adjust the quantity based on its size and activity level.
Ensure your turtle has access to clean, fresh water at all times. You can also offer occasional soaks in shallow water to help with hydration.
